Output ead00e3f83df9566094c49e006d7ec2572657959c00025399db16f120eae8eae:12

value
669417
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2314ae2ae338151de1861776413e3b5f0ba7e38 OP_EQUAL
address
3HwDFbQTNx3vSrYNqvRG39jmt7KsABq3nm
transaction
ead00e3f83df9566094c49e006d7ec2572657959c00025399db16f120eae8eae
spent
true